What is apostille certification Florida?
Information on Apostille and Notarial Certificates issued by the Florida Department of State. The 1961 Hague Convention established the apostille as a form of authentication for its member states. The apostille certifies the authenticity of the issuing official’s signature.

What is the difference between a notary and an apostille?
One easy way to remember the difference is that notarized documents are used only within the United States. In contrast, an apostille is used as a form of authentication between different countries. How much is apostille in Florida?
$20.00 per document, for documents certified by any Clerk of the Court for any county in Florida when requesting an apostille. ($10 for Apostille; $10 for Certificate of Incumbency.)

How to obtain an apostille for Florida documentation?
Fortunately, getting an apostille in Florida is very straightforward. To get an apostille certificate, you must complete a Florida Department of State Apostille and Notarial Certificate Request Form, which can be found online. Along with the form, you must also send to the Florida Department of State: The notarized document you want authenticated.
